5 MENU MODE I MENU mode items (Continued) D Dimmer Brightness (Manually) "DISP MAN." Set the brightness manually to suit your own preferences. • 0-100 : Setting dimmer level manually from 0 (OFF) to 100. D Dimmer Response "DISP RESP." Set the dimmer switching speed when selecting "AUTO" at the "Dimmer Mode." • STANDARD : Selecting switch speed is normal. • FAST : Selecting switch speed is fast. D Frequency Display "FREQ DISP" Set the 1 kHz digit frequency displaying to the OLED. • OFF : The 1 kHz digit always does not display on the OLED. • ON : The 1 kHz digit always display on the OLED. • ZERO SUPP. : The 1 kHz digit display on the OLED (Except the digit is 0). D USER-1 Setting "U-1 ID SET" Set the USER-1, channel tag, to the desired ID. q Push [MEM] to enter the U-1 ID edit mode. w Rotate [DIAL] to select the desired character. e Rotate [O-DIAL] to select the next input digit. r Repeat w-e to input the U-1 ID. t Push [MEM] again to store the U-1 ID, and exit the edit mode. D USER-2 Setting "U-2 ID SET" Set the USER-2, channel tag, to the desired ID. q Push [MEM] to enter the U-2 ID edit mode. w Rotate [DIAL] to select the desired character. e Rotate [O-DIAL] to select the next input digit. r Repeat w-e to input the U-2 ID. t Push [MEM] again to store the U-2 ID, and exit the edit mode. D External Input "AUX IN" Set the external input mode. • OFF : The external input does not use. • ON : The external input is available while squelch is closing. • INCOM : The external input is available with the intercom opera- tions as following. - The intercom function is OFF. - While the intercom function does not use. - While audio signal does not input to the intercom's mi- crophone. 26
